(<a title=\"The Financial Times\" href=\"https:\/\/www.ft.com\/intl\/cms\/s\/2\/a00708b6-df92-11e4-a06a-00144feab7de.html#axzz3ZBEdiCXS\" target=\"_blank\">The Financial Times<\/a>)<\/p>\n<h4>Moving downtown, opening up opportunity<\/h4>\n<p dir=\"ltr\"><a title=\"business school\" href=\"https:\/\/www.simon.rochester.edu\/\" target=\"_blank\">The University of Rochester&#8217;s Simon Business School&#8217;s<\/a> recent move from Midtown Manhattan to Downtown will open an opportunity for the upstate-based MBA program and New York Law School to share their curricula. Why? The two will now be housed in the same building. Officials from both schools say this will allow them to integrate legal and business education. Some real good can come out of that. (<a title=\"mba news\" href=\"https:\/\/www.crainsnewyork.com\/article\/20150428\/REAL_ESTATE\/150429842\/new-york-law-school-seeks-to-partner-with-business-school-at-its-tribeca-space\" target=\"_blank\">Crain\u2019s New York Business<\/a>)<\/p>\n<h4>Best social life ever<\/h4>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">With innumerous assignments, must-attend networking events, and financial pressures, a hard-charging MBA student needs to unwind from time to time. Actually, a healthy social life is one of the most important aspects of the business school experience. Finding that healthy balance between work and play is crucial to how well you may do, opines Harvey Berkey, CEO of online grad school guide <a title=\"graduate school programs\" href=\"https:\/\/www.graduateprograms.com\/\" target=\"_blank\">Graduateprograms.com<\/a>. The website surveyed more than 10,000 current and former MBA students to find out which business schools have the best social scene, which includes accessibility, making friends, and yes&#8230;dating. Topping the list is Spain\u2019s <a title=\"esade\" href=\"https:\/\/www.esade.edu\/\" target=\"_blank\">ESADE<\/a>, located in beautiful Barcelona. Following in second: the <a title=\"UNC business school\" href=\"https:\/\/www.kenan-flagler.unc.edu\/\" target=\"_blank\">University of North Carolina\u2019s Kenan-Flagler Business School<\/a>.
